GUITARS! celebrates one of the world’s best known instruments

The Revelstoke Jazz Club performance features talented Shuswap and area guitarists.

The Revelstoke Jazz Club will be hosting a six-string extravaganza on Friday, Feb. 15.

GUITARS! is an indulgent celebration of the world’s coolest instrument, inspired by the multitude of incredible guitarists who live in the Shuswap and surrounding area.

Curated by Jake Verburg and Jordan Dick, GUITARS delves deep into the musical personalities of four unique guitarists and the music that inspires them to play. Past concerts have seen them pay tribute to jazz giants like Django Reinhardt and Wes Montgomery as well as rock icons Jimi Hendrix, and The Beatles.

The evening features Verburg and Dick, along with Dan Smith and Blair Shier on guitars and Gareth Seys on drums.

GUITARS! takes place at the Jazz Club (located in the Selkirk Room at the Regent Hotel) on Friday, Feb. 15. Doors open at 7 p.m. and music runs from 7:30–9:30 p.m. Admission is by donation.
